When I first started my non-toxic beauty and lifestyle journey in 2017, I was overwhelmed by all of the information I was receiving. It can be overwhelming to know what skincare products are considered non-toxic and which ingredients to avoid.
Non-toxic ingredients mean that the ingredients are pure and consciously sourced to ensure no harmful effects to people who are using the products.
Whenever you are looking for something new, whether it's shampoo, lotion, makeup, (anything that can absorb into your skin) be sure to check the ingredients label! This will give you the best information as to what is inside the products, and how these ingredients can affect your health.
